About The Position

The Medical Laboratory Technologist performs analytical tests and procedures offered by the Department of Pathology and Laboratory Medicine using appropriate methodologies and quality assurance techniques. The Medical Laboratory Technologist possesses the technical ability and problem-solving skills to perform all tests (both manual and automated) in the clinical and environmental laboratories. Performs laboratory tests with a network of steps and variables according to established protocols and works with little or no supervision in emergency and weekend/night situations. Operates instruments that are often computer integrated and networked and uses computerized information systems. Compares test results to pre-established criteria (reference intervals) and makes decisions regarding the reportability of results, thus exercising independent judgment. Stressful working conditions require the Medical Laboratory Technologist to be tactful, sensitive and able to communicate effectively and professionally. Maintains patient confidentiality at all times as deemed essential by the Medical Laboratory Technologist Code of Conduct.
